Cauliflower and Tomato Mix is a nutritious and versatile dish incorporating fresh cauliflower florets and juicy tomatoes, often seasoned with a blend of spices like garlic, turmeric, or cumin. This simple yet flavorful combination is popular in Indian, Mediterranean, and fusion cuisines, offering a delightful balance of texture and taste. Cauliflower is low in calories but high in fiber, vitamin C, and antioxidants, making it great for digestion and immune support. Tomatoes contribute lycopene, a potent antioxidant linked to heart health, along with vitamins A and K. The dish is typically cooked with minimal oil, keeping it light and heart-healthy, though recipes with excess oil or rich creams may be less ideal for certain diets. Whether served as a side or a standalone entrée, this plant-based mix is a wholesome choice brimming with nutrients and bold flavors.
